| #ifndef _DECAF_CONCURRENT_MUTEX_H_ |
| #define _DECAF_CONCURRENT_MUTEX_H_ |
| |
| #include <decaf/util/concurrent/Synchronizable.h> |
| #include <decaf/util/concurrent/Concurrent.h> |
| #include <decaf/lang/Thread.h> |
| #include <decaf/util/Config.h> |
| |
| #include <apr_pools.h> |
| #include <apr_thread_mutex.h> |
| #include <apr_thread_cond.h> |
| |
| #include <list> |
| #include <assert.h> |
| |
| namespace decaf{ |
| namespace util{ |
| namespace concurrent{ |
| |
| /** |
| * Creates a pthread_mutex_t object. The object is created |
| * such that successive locks from the same thread is allowed |
| * and will be successful. |
| * @see pthread_mutex_t |
| */ |
| class DECAF_API Mutex : public Synchronizable { |
| private: |
| |
| // APR Pool Allocator |
| apr_pool_t* pool; |
| |
| // The mutex object. |
| apr_thread_mutex_t* mutex; |
| |
| // List of waiting threads |
| std::list<apr_thread_cond_t*> eventQ; |
| |
| // Lock Status Members |
| volatile unsigned long lock_owner; |
| volatile unsigned long lock_count; |
| |
| public: |
| |
| /** |
| * Constructor - creates and initializes the mutex. |
| */ |
| Mutex(); |
| |
| /** |
| * Destructor - destroys the mutex object. |
| */ |
| virtual ~Mutex(); |
| |
| /** |
| * Locks the object. |
| * @throws ActiveMQException |
| */ |
| virtual void lock() throw( lang::Exception ); |
| |
| /** |
| * Unlocks the object. |
| * @throws ActiveMQException |
| */ |
| virtual void unlock() throw( lang::Exception ); |
| |
| /** |
| * Waits on a signal from this object, which is generated |
| * by a call to Notify. |
| * @throws ActiveMQException |
| */ |
| virtual void wait() throw( lang::Exception ); |
| |
| /** |
| * Waits on a signal from this object, which is generated |
| * by a call to Notify. Must have this object locked before |
| * calling. This wait will timeout after the specified time |
| * interval. |
| * @param millisecs the time in milliseconds to wait. |
| * @throws ActiveMQException |
| */ |
| virtual void wait( unsigned long millisecs ) |
| throw( lang::Exception ); |
| |
| /** |
| * Signals a waiter on this object that it can now wake |
| * up and continue. |
| * @throws ActiveMQException |
| */ |
| virtual void notify() throw( lang::Exception ); |
| |
| /** |
| * Signals the waiters on this object that it can now wake |
| * up and continue. |
| * @throws ActiveMQException |
| */ |
| virtual void notifyAll() throw( lang::Exception ); |
| |
| private: |
| |
| /** |
| * Check if the calling thread is the Lock Owner |
| * @retun true if the caller is the lock owner |
| */ |
| bool isLockOwner(){ |
| return lock_owner == lang::Thread::getId(); |
| } |
| |
| }; |
| |
| }}} |
| |
| #endif /*_DECAF_CONCURRENT_MUTEX_H_*/ |
